#scheme #r7rs #file #repl #r7rs-small #run #interpretor-compiler

bin+lib ruschm

Scheme(R7RS-small) interpretor/compiler rust implementation

5 releases

0.2.0 Apr 27, 2021
0.2.0-alpha.0 Apr 14, 2021
0.1.3 Jul 16, 2020
0.1.2 Jul 14, 2020

#3 in #r7rs

MIT license

285KB
7.5K SLoC

Ruschm

Coverage Status Join the chat at https://gitter.im/RustScheme/community

An extendable Scheme(R7RS-small) interpretor/compiler rust implementation

type cargo run to start the repl, cargo run file to interpret an r7rs source file.

Dependencies

~5–12MB
~147K SLoC